When a Honda TPMS system detects a problem, the TPMS control unit sets a code, but shifts to fail-safe mode and does not alert the driver to low tire pressures. Once the code is set, on the next key cycle, the TPMS light will flash between 30-90 seconds and then remain on. A healthy system will flash the light for two seconds and then turn off.

The low tire pressure/TPMS indicator may come on with a delay or may not come on at all when: You rapidly accelerate, decelerate, or turn the steering wheel. You drive on snowy or slippery roads. Tire chains are used. The low tire pressure/TPMS indicator may come on under the following conditions: A compact spare tire* is used. Resetting Tire Pressure Sensor. Therefore, I went to F*******E to reset it (again). Same story, the light was on (again ..., The TPMS malfunction indicator is combined with the low tire pressure telltale. When the system detects a malfunction, the telltale will flash for approximately one minute and then remain continuously illuminated. This sequence will continue upon subsequent vehicle start-ups as long as the malfunction exists., uuWhen DrivinguTire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) Driving. You must start TPMS calibration every time you: • Adjust the pressure in one or more tires. • Rotate the tires. • Replace one or more tires. Before calibrating the TPMS: • Set the cold tire pressure in all four tires. 2Checking TiresP. 594., Detail. The calibration process requires approximately 30 minutes of cumulative driving at speeds between 31-62 mph (50-100 km/h). During this period, if power mode is set to ON and the vehicle is not moved within 45 seconds, you may notice the low tire pressure indicator comes on briefly., Mechanic for Honda: Amedee.
